All newer videocards(made in the last 2ish years), have the ability to use system ram as local vram, it's a bit slower(really do you notice 1ms transfer rates? really now). And directx10 and higher allow caching to system ram for vram if there is insufficient vram.

What it comes down to is whether or not the game will allow caching to non-vram. My GTX450 has 1gb of vram, but it also uses 1gb of system ram giving me 2gb in total.

Since you have a 32-bit system, your system can only make use of about 3.75 gigs of ram, no matter how much physical memory you slap in the machine.  It has no idea where the "extra" is, it's like tryiing to google a street address that doesn't exist.

In order to make use of more than that 3.75 gigs of RAM, you have to upgrade to a 64-bit system and a 64-bit OS.

But 3.75 will probably be plenty if you've still got XP--Vista and 7 eat more memory for the OS so you need even more memory to run games smoothly.  But XP is (relatively) low-resource IIRC.
